“Concerned” MPs write to developers over power station plan

April 15, 2014
15 Apr 2014

Two “extremely concerned” Suffolk MPs have written to the developers of a proposed £200-million gas-fired station planned for Eye, amid the application for the project being submitted to the Planning Inspectorate.

Progress Power, which hopes to build the station at Eye Airfield, submitted the application on March 31. Read more →

Cash boost for Eye Community Centre

April 15, 2014
15 Apr 2014

Eye town mayor Linda Cummins presented a cheque for £180 to Eye Community Centre at the start of its monthly bingo night.

The money was raised by a successful Saturday afternoon bridge session, organised by the mayor, and helped by members of Eye bridge club who meet every Wednesday at the centre. Read more →

Heating Oil Thefts – Protect Your Oil

April 1, 2014
01 Apr 2014

Around 600ltrs of heating oil were stolen from a tank at a home in Cock Road, Eye sometime between 9am Sunday 23rd & 5pm Sunday 30th March.

Also, at around 3.30am Sunday morning, 31st March, a window was smashed at a home in Cross Street, Eye.

If you have any information about these crimes please contact Suffolk Police on 101 quoting reference ST/14/ 891 + 887. Read more →
